I spent a while trying to make sense of the new talent system soon after we were able to log in today, but after futzing with it and getting frustrated I decided to just get started on leveling a druid (switching mains for the expansion). Chose resto as my primary tree in case I need to heal something along the way, and questing is easy enough to not really require a DPS spec. The resto tree as a whole is extremely janky right now. I know it will get the proper love before release, but the whole talent system feels very uninspiring at the moment (for example, in some trees you need to spec into almost every single talent just to progress down the tree). In terms of resto, Swiftmend is a duplicate talent (it exists in talent and freebie form, just from selecting the tree as your primary), and Tree of Life has been drastically changed (which I am in favor of), but doesn't seem to affect the non-healing spells that are listed for it. Plus the filler talents feel very awkward.
